The White House did not immediately respond to a request for further details of the deal. Earlier in the day, Trump had only said he was considering giving Hungary a reprieve. “Sure, we’re looking at it, because it’s very difficult for [Hungary] to get the oil and gas from other areas,” he told reporters sitting alongside Orbán. “They don’t have the advantage of having sea. … They don’t have the ports. They have a difficult problem.”
